Review: Dell Inspiron Mini 9 netbook with Ubuntu Linux
DELL'S entry into the PC netbook market, the Inspiron Mini 9, landed on my desk last week – and I have to say I quite liked it, but with one or two reservations.
Competing with the likes of the Asus Eee and Acer Aspire One, my shiny black test unit ran Ubuntu Linux 8.04, which has been modified for netbook usage and offers both the normal Ubuntu menu plus a series of tabbed desktop shortcuts.
